Description Betacommand 2014-04-06 22:17:34 UTC
Provide a tracking category (configurable via mediawiki message) that tracks existing links that trigger the SBL that are not whitelisted.

This would enable identification, tracking and cleanup of articles with problematic URLs, and for the most part make http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/User:Cyberbot_II obsolete.
